SV Progress Tracker
2+
3+
Track your Stardew Valley progress locally in your browser by dropping in your save file. No data leaves your device.
4+
5+
What it does
6+
7+
- Parses your Stardew Valley save file (XML) fully in the browser
8+
- Shows clean, visual progress for:
9+
- Skills and XP toward the next level
10+
- Cooking recipes known and cooked counts
11+
- Crafting recipes made
12+
- Crops shipped (Monoculture/Polyculture helpers)
13+
- Fish caught
14+
- Friendship levels and heart progress for dateable NPCs
15+
- Monsters killed by category (Adventurer's Guild)
16+
- Items shipped and total money earned
17+
- Museum collection (artifacts and minerals) with found vs. donated
18+
- Supports single player and farmhands; view each player via tabs

How it works (privacy-first)
21+
22+
- Runs entirely client-side (React + Vite); your save file is parsed with fast-xml-parser in your browser
23+
- No uploads, no servers, no storage by default
24+
25+
How to use
26+
27+
1) Open the app: https://thecoderaccoons.github.io/svprogresstracker
28+
2) Drag-and-drop your save file into the drop area, or click to choose the file
29+
3) Switch between tabs to view Skills, Achievements, and more for each player/farmhand
30+
31+
Where to find your save file
32+
33+
- Windows: C:\Users\YourUser\AppData\Roaming\StardewValley\Saves\<FarmName>_########
34+
- macOS: ~/Library/Application Support/StardewValley/Saves/<FarmName>_########
35+
- Linux: ~/.config/StardewValley/Saves/<FarmName>_########
36+
37+
Note: Drop the file named the same as your farm (without the folder extension) e.g., FarmName_123456789.

Deployment (via GitHub Releases → GitHub Pages)
57+
58+
This repo deploys to GitHub Pages when a Release is published.
59+
60+
- Workflow file: .github/workflows/release-pages.yml
61+
- Trigger: release published
62+
- Build: Vite builds to build/
63+
- Deploy: Official Pages actions publish the artifact
64+
65+
First-time GitHub setup
66+
67+
1) Push the workflow to the default branch
68+
2) Create a Release (e.g., v1.0.0). The workflow builds and deploys
69+
3) In Settings → Pages, set Build and deployment to GitHub Actions
